Entendendo SSL/TLS: Segurança na Web
SSL (Secure Sockets Layer) e TLS (Transport Layer Security) são protocolos essenciais para a segurança de dados na internet. Eles garantem que as informações trocadas entre um usuário e um site sejam criptografadas e, portanto, protegidas contra interceptações. Com a crescente preocupação com a privacidade online, entender como esses protocolos funcionam é crucial para qualquer pessoa que navegue na web.
O que é SSL/TLS?
O SSL foi desenvolvido pela Netscape na década de 1990, enquanto o TLS é uma versão mais segura e atualizada do SSL. Basicamente, ambos os protocolos têm a mesma função: proteger dados que são enviados pela internet. Quando você acessa um site que utiliza SSL/TLS, seu navegador estabelece uma conexão segura, garantindo que os dados trocados permaneçam confidenciais e íntegros.
Como funciona o SSL/TLS?
O funcionamento do SSL/TLS pode ser dividido em algumas etapas principais:
- Handshake: É a primeira etapa, onde o cliente (navegador) e o servidor trocam informações para estabelecer uma conexão segura.
- Criptografia: Após o handshake, os dados são criptografados, o que significa que mesmo que sejam interceptados, não poderão ser lidos.
- Integridade dos dados: O protocolo também garante que os dados não sejam alterados durante a transmissão.
Esses passos ajudam a criar um ambiente seguro para transações online, como compras em e-commerce e troca de informações sensíveis.
Importância do SSL/TLS na Segurança Online
Com o aumento de fraudes online e ataques cibernéticos, o uso de SSL/TLS se tornou uma necessidade. Aqui estão algumas razões pelas quais são tão importantes:
- Proteção de dados sensíveis: SSL/TLS protege informações pessoais, como senhas e números de cartão de crédito, durante a transmissão.
- Confiabilidade: Sites que utilizam SSL/TLS são mais confiáveis aos olhos dos usuários, aumentando a probabilidade de conversões e interações.
- SEO: O Google favorece sites que têm certificação SSL, o que pode impactar positivamente seu posicionamento nos resultados de busca.
Exemplo Prático
Considere um site de e-commerce que não utiliza SSL/TLS. Um usuário insere suas informações de pagamento, mas essas informações não estão criptografadas. Um hacker pode facilmente interceptar esses dados, resultando em roubo de identidade e fraudes. Com SSL/TLS, esses dados são criptografados, tornando muito mais difícil para os hackers acessarem.
Como implementar SSL/TLS em seu site?
Implementar SSL/TLS em um site é um processo mais simples do que muitos imaginam. Aqui estão os passos básicos:
- Escolher um Certificado SSL: Existem várias opções no mercado, desde gratuitos (como Let’s Encrypt) até pagos, que oferecem diferentes níveis de validação e suporte.
- Instalar o Certificado: A instalação varia dependendo do servidor que você está utilizando, mas muitos provedores de hospedagem têm tutoriais ou suporte para ajudar.
- Configurar seu site: Após a instalação, você deve redirecionar o tráfego HTTP para HTTPS, garantindo que todos os visitantes usem a conexão segura.
Esses passos não apenas protegem os dados dos usuários, mas também ajudam a construir confiança e credibilidade para o seu site.
Aplicações práticas de SSL/TLS no dia a dia
O uso de SSL/TLS se estende além de sites de e-commerce. Aqui estão algumas aplicações práticas:
- Emails Seguros: Provedores de email como Gmail e Outlook utilizam SSL/TLS para criptografar mensagens, protegendo informações pessoais durante a troca.
- Redes Sociais: Plataformas como Facebook e Twitter utilizam SSL/TLS para proteger os dados dos usuários durante a navegação e interação.
- Aplicativos Móveis: Muitos aplicativos que requerem login ou troca de dados pessoais utilizam SSL/TLS para garantir a segurança das informações.
Conceitos relacionados
Para um entendimento mais profundo, é interessante conhecer alguns conceitos relacionados ao SSL/TLS:
- Criptografia: A técnica fundamental que permite a proteção de dados, sendo a base do funcionamento do SSL/TLS.
- HTTPS: A versão segura do HTTP, que utiliza SSL/TLS para proteger a comunicação na web.
- Firewall: Embora não seja um protocolo de criptografia, os firewalls ajudam a proteger os dados ao bloquear acessos não autorizados.
Reflexão Final
Compreender o funcionamento e a importância do SSL/TLS é essencial para qualquer pessoa que navegue na internet hoje. Não apenas protege suas informações, mas também contribui para um ambiente online mais seguro e confiável. Ao implementar SSL/TLS em seus próprios projetos online, você não apenas está fazendo sua parte na segurança da web, mas também ajudando a construir uma internet mais confiável para todos.
Agora que você conhece mais sobre SSL/TLS, que tal verificar se os sites que você utiliza regularmente implementam essas tecnologias de segurança? Essa simples ação pode fazer uma grande diferença na proteção dos seus dados!